Marty Wise #22 |
|
6'6"...205...Senior...Forward |
2005-06: Played in 33 of USI 34 games as a junior, started eight
contests...averaged 6.8 points and 5.5 rebound per game...5.5 rpg ranked
third on the team and 16th in the GLVC...ranked second on the team and ninth
in the GLVC with a 2.5 assist-to-turnover ratio...also was second on the
team and 12th in the league with 111 assists...had a season-high 16 points
and 12 rebounds in the home win over Central State University...had a
season-best 10 assists in the win over Robert Morris College...recorded two
double-doubles in his first season with USI.
TRANSFER: Joins the USI men's basketball program after two years at Moberly Area Community College...named third team All-American and first team All-Region as a sophomore...averaged 13.0 points, 8.0 rebounds, and 4.0 assists per game in 2004-05...helped MACC to a 30-7 overall record and to the NJCAA national championship game.
HIGH SCHOOL: Lettered in basketball at Alcee Fortier High School (New Orleans, Louisiana).
PERSONAL: Born December 31..son of Donna Wise.
